Wuxiangshan
Wuxiangshan station is a station on and the southern terminus of the suburban Line S7 of the Nanjing Metro. It commenced operations along with the rest of the line on 26 May 2018.Photo: Whisper of the heart, CC BY-SA 4.0.

Xingzhuang station is a station on the suburban Line S7 of the Nanjing Metro. It commenced operations along with the rest of the line on 26 May 2018. Xingzhuang is situated 2 km north of Wuxiangshan.
